TEAM BUILDING EXAMPLE ~ HALF DAY SESSION ~ Available for small to large groups.

Time: 9:00 a.m. – 12:00 noon

We will begin with a series of thirty-minute initiatives which will involve all participants in ice breaking games.  Our lead team members will discuss the goals, the full value contract, and the itinerary for the day.  All participants will commit to supporting each other as they attempt new challenges which may be outside their “zone of comfort”.  One of the underlying themes is that teams need to stretch to grow.  To do so requires support from one’s associates.

The large group games will involve learning one another’s names and snap decision making through a face paced initiative entitled Cog Wheels.  This will be followed up by a quick thinking, low energy event, “Bizz Buzz”.  (9:00 – 9:30 a.m.)

We will then break into groups of six, which can be handled randomly on the spot or be predetermined by the client.  Each group of approximately eleven will rotate in 20-minute blocks through all six stations.  (9:30 – 11:30 a.m.)  These games will build trust, out of the box thinking, the value of leadership and followship, as well as the importance of strategic planning.

Some games will involve moderate to high levels of activity; others only clear thinking and low movement.  An example of the former is Keypunch wherein team members rapidly touch files numbered 1 to 30 inside a rectangular perimeter as quickly as possible, while the later is best seen in the participants joining in pairs, one sighted and one blinded to assemble a giant puzzle.  Protocols which will be explained on site may simplify or complicate these procedures, not unlike the work day world.

All activities will be related to one’s work, and in fact are quite useful as teaching take- aways regarding employee relations, development of product and customer relations.  All games will be explained, then taken part in, then debriefed.

We will close the day by joining in a large group (11:30 a.m. – 12:00 noon).    Participants will take part in one last event then contribute concluding comments.  At the morning’s end, we will have experienced laughter and learning, connectedness and collaboration, the importance of planning and valuing all of the team members contribution.
